Join us at Raine Square for the Microenterprise People Pop-Up, a unique event dedicated to showcasing the incredible talents of local artists and entrepreneurs with disabilities. This special event is designed to empower individuals through microenterprise opportunities, helping them achieve their career aspirations.

About : MICROENTERPRISE PEOPLE (MEP) and the MEP MARKETPLACE

Microenterprise People Inc. (MEP) is a not-for-profit Association made up of passionate, values driven and experienced Customised Employment Practitioners. MEP’s overarching goal is to support People with Disability (PwD) to achieve meaningful employment, whatever that looks like! 

The first MEP Marketplace opened on 18th December 2023 after Activate Perth offered them a fantastic retail space opportunity.  

Since then, MEP have opened at 2 other locations and the pop up shop in Raine Square will be their 4th.  MEP Marketplaces sell products from over 50 Microenterprise Owners, all owned and operated by PWD, and staffed by 25 PWD earning retail award rates. 100% of sales go directly to the microenterprise owners.

The shop removes the barriers for Microenterprises to sell in a prominent retail location by not only eliminating the overhead costs, but also supporting them with the administration, stock management, and some of the more challenging “business” tasks, all the while working with them to build skills to ultimately do all this themselves.

“Australia has one of the lowest employment rates for people with disability in the OECD, ranking at 21 out of the 29 countries. This means people with disability represent one of Australia's greatest underrepresented talent pools.”  17 July 2023.  (2023, Business Council of Australia).
